Cómo Construir Un Paquete Deb

Tabla de contenido:

Cómo Construir Un Paquete Deb
Cómo Construir Un Paquete Deb

Video: Cómo Construir Un Paquete Deb

Video: Cómo Construir Un Paquete Deb
Video: How to Create .deb Packages for Debian, Ubuntu and Linux Mint 2024, Abril
Anonim

Los paquetes Deb en Linux son una especie de alternativa al formato.msi en Windows. El archivo.deb es un archivo autoextraíble de un programa. La aparición de este formato de archivo facilitó enormemente la instalación de aplicaciones, que anteriormente se realizaba compilando desde la fuente, lo que a veces era bastante difícil tanto para principiantes como para usuarios avanzados de Linux.

Cómo construir un paquete deb
Cómo construir un paquete deb

Necesario

archivo con el código fuente de la aplicación requerida

Instrucciones

Paso 1

Primero, compruebe si el programa que necesita está en formato.deb en Internet. Muchas aplicaciones populares han tenido un instalador automático durante mucho tiempo. Si no hay un paquete deb para su sistema, puede descargar de forma segura las fuentes de la utilidad necesaria.

Paso 2

Asegúrese de haber instalado todos los programas que necesita para compilar. Para hacer esto, en Terminal (Menú - Programas - Accesorios - Terminal) ingrese el siguiente comando: sudo apt-get install libtool autotools-dev dpkg-buildpackage fakeroot También puede instalar estas bibliotecas desde el administrador de paquetes Synaptic en Ubuntu.

Paso 3

Prepara un directorio de trabajo en el que realizarás todas las operaciones. Cree una carpeta conveniente para usted y descomprima su programa descargado en ella.

Paso 4

Abra Terminal y navegue hasta el directorio apropiado. Por ejemplo: cd / src / my_program / program_123Program_123 es el directorio donde se encuentran todos los archivos de la aplicación.

Paso 5

Realice la construcción inicial:./ configure && make A continuación, necesita "debianizar". En el mismo directorio, ejecute el comando: dh_make

Paso 6

A continuación, deberá seleccionar el tipo de paquete. El más utilizado es "binario único". Para seleccionarlo, simplemente ingrese la letra "s".

Paso 7

Abra el directorio "debian" creado y edite el archivo "control". Ingrese una descripción para el programa. Estas son las palabras que verá el usuario cuando mire el contenido del paquete en Synaptic.

Paso 8

Abra debian / rules. Descomente la línea "dh_install" quitando el "#" al principio.

Paso 9

En Terminal ingrese: dpkg-buildpackage –rfakeroot Y navegue al directorio un nivel más arriba y vea su contenido: cd.. && ls

Paso 10

Entre el resto de archivos, verá el paquete deb recién creado. Puede instalarlo haciendo doble clic en el archivo.

Recomendado: